Todd Rosenberg

SVP, Business Development and Content Strategy, Universal Music Group

Combining an entrepreneurial approach with business development and operational expertise, Todd has a 20+ year track record of developing and leading successful ventures within entertainment, technology and advertising companies. Todd has grown revenue, audience and brand visibility through partnerships with the world’s largest corporations, agencies and brands including Walmart, IAC, Lucasfilm, Warner Brothers, YouTube, ESPN, BBC, Pixar and Facebook. Todd currently serves as the SVP of Business Development and Content Strategy at the Universal Music Group. Before Universal, Todd served as VP of Business Development and Operations at The Walt Disney Company. As a digital thought leader and executive at The Walt Disney Company, Todd pioneered the company’s content claiming business, creating a multimillion-dollar profit center spanning all Disney’s content divisions. He was promoted in 2016 to oversee the entire Maker Studios Network including partnerships, audience development, platform management and operations. Prior to Disney, Todd spearheaded the development of OpenX’s programmatic advertising exchange. During his time with OpenX, net revenue increased by more than 60x to exceed $100 million, and he transitioned from an operational to a strategic role informing product, sales, legal and marketing. Todd is also active in the Los Angeles start-up community, working with prominent venture funds, accelerators and advising early stage companies. His career began in the music industry as a creative executive for the world’s foremost record labels, discovering and fostering talent, curating film soundtracks and compilations, and licensing music. He is a native Angeleno, with a B.A. from the University of Michigan and an MBA from USC Marshall School of Business.
